Overview
The Bulk Edit feature allows users to simultaneously change the status, effective date, end date, principal or affiliation role, and custom title for multiple selected Person Associations on a Person record.
Availability: All customers.
Important: Bulk editing, like editing an individual Association record, will replace the existing Association details and will not retain previous entries for historical reference. Proceed carefully.
Access the Person's Profile and Associations
- Navigate to the People section and select the record of the person you would like to edit from multiple entities
- Click on the Associations tab
Filter and Select Associations
- Click on the Filter button to filter by the Status or the Role
- In the Status dropdown, select to view either Active or Inactive associations
- In the Roles dropdown, select the roles you wish to edit and click Apply
- Note: All roles can be bulk edited (except Beneficial Owners, as they're maintained in Securities as Holdings)
- Click on Apply
- Click on the top checkbox to select all associations, or click the checkboxes of the individual associations to be edited
- Click on the [X] Selected dropdown at the top
Perform the Bulk Edit
- Select Bulk Edit from the dropdown
- In the Bulk Edit modal, make any applicable edits as needed:
- Select the new Status (Confirmed, Pending or Inactive) from the available dropdown
- Select the new Effective Date and an optional End Date
- Select the new Principal Role or Affiliation Role from the available dropdown
- Apply any Custom Title from the dropdown
- Click the Manage [Role] Custom Title button to add a new custom title option
- Click Apply to execute the bulk edit
- The selected associations will disappear from the list after the update if you have applied filters that no longer apply. Click the Filter dropdown and click Clear All Filters to view the newly edited associations, which will now reflect any edits made (new Status, Dates, Role).
